Fixed Dial Number (FDN)
(Menu 9.5.2)
Allows you to restrict your outgoing calls to selected
phone numbers, if this function is supported by your
SIM card. The PIN2 code is required.
The following options are available:
]
Enable: You can only call phone numbers stored in
the Address Book. You must enter your PIN2.
]
Disable: You can call any number.
]
Number List: You can view the number list saved as
fixed dial number.
Change Codes
(Menu 9.5.3)
The Change codes feature allows you to change your
current password to a new one. You must enter the
current password before you can specify a new one.
You can change the access codes: Security Code,
PIN1 Code, PIN2 Code

World Phone
(Menu 9.6.1)
When the America(850/1900) option is selected the
device can be used in the US, and when the
Europe(1800) option is chosen the device can be
used in European countries.
Note
The US frequency is set at 850/1900 MHz and
the European frequency is set at 1800 MHz.
